dybvig bf38db8ed9 - modified floatify_normalize to properly round denormalized results and
obviated scale_float in the process.
    number.c,
    ieee.ms
- fixed 0eNNNN for large NNNN to produce 0.0 rather than infinity
    strnum.ss,
    5_3.ms
- the reader now raises an exception with condition type implementation
  restriction (among the other usual lexical condition types), and
  string->number now raises #f, for #e<m>@<a>, where <m> and <a> are
  nonzero integers, since Chez Scheme can't represent polar numbers other
  than 0@<a> and <m>@0 exactly.  <m>@<a> still produces an inexact result,
  i.e., we're still extending the set of inexact numeric constants beyond
  what R6RS dictates.  doing this required a rework of $str->num, which
  turned into a fairly extensive rewrite that fixed up a few other minor
  issues (like r6rs:string->number improperly allowing 1/2e10) and
  eliminated the need for consumers to call $str->num twice in cases
  where it actually produces a number.  added some related new tests,
  including several found lacking by profiling.  added a couple of
  checks to number->string whose absence was causing argument errors to
  be reported by other routines.
    strnum.ss, exceptions.ss, read.ss
    5_3.ms, 6.ms, root-experr*, patch*
- added pdtml flag, which if set to t causes profile-dump-html to be
  called at the end of a mat run.

Chez Scheme is a compiler and run-time system for the language of the Revised^6 Report on Scheme (R6RS), with numerous extensions. The compiler generates native code for each target processor, with support for x86, x86_64, and 32-bit PowerPC architectures.
